Walter Isaacson - Biography

Biography of Isaacson: Life and Contribution to World History

Walter is a name familiar to anyone interested in great personality biographies and history. This eminent biographer and historian was born on May 21, 1952, in New Orleans, Louisiana. Since then, his life has been saturated with research, book writing and an important role in uncovering the life stories of some of the greatest personalities in world history.

Walter developed an interest in history and biographies from childhood. He grew up in South Louisiana, where history and culture have always played an important role. His parents supported his interests and encouraged the study of the past.

After graduating from high school, Walter attended Harvard University, where he studied history and literature. His passion for biographies became increasingly apparent during his studies, and he began to write articles for university publications.

After receiving a bachelor's degree from Harvard, Walter Isaacson entered the University of Oxford on Rhode Island, where he was engaged in research in the field of English literature. Upon returning to the United States, he began working as a journalist and quickly became one of the most respected authors and editors.

However, the real turning point in his career was the decision to start working on biographies of great personalities. His first biography was a book about Benjamin Franklin, one of the most influential figures in United States history. This work opened new horizons for Walter Isaacson and made him one of the leading biographers in the world.
